Institute Associate Scientist III, In Vivo Pharmacology
Institute Associate Scientist III, In Vivo Pharmacology Job Category: Research Sub Category: Research Department: Applied Cancer Science Inst Salary: Employment Status: Full Time Work Week: Mon-Fri Shift: Days
KEY FUNCTIONS
1. Under minimal supervision, helps establish and validate mechanistic and functional cell based studies for evaluating novel therapeutic targets. 2. Independently designs and utilizes novel in vivo xenograft and allograft models. 3. Doses animals and analyzes the outcome of pharmacokinetic, pharmacodynamic and efficacy studies. 4. Performs survival and non-survival animal surgeries for specimen collection and characterization. 5. Utilizes non-invasive imaging. 6. Assists in utilization of in vivo models. 7. Contributes to project team.

Support team decisions once they are made and help to implement. EDUCATION
Required: Bachelor's degree in Biology, Biochemistry, molecular biology, cell biology, enzymology, pharmacology, chemistry or related field from an accredited university Preferred: Masters degree in one of the sciences.
EXPERIENCE
Required: With Bachelor's degree, three years of relevant research experience in lab. With Master's degree, at least one year of same experience. Preferred: 1. In vivo pharmacology experience including animal handling, dosing, and conducting drug PK/PD and efficacy studies with mice is required. 2. Experience with in vivo models including subcutaneous and orthotopic xenografts or genetically engineered models of cancer. 3. Experience maintaining cell lines in tissue culture, preparing reagents and dosing solutions. 4. Hands-on experience administering test agents by gavage or intravenous and intraperitoneal injections required. 5. Ability to perform tumor measurements is essential. 6. Must have prior experience with minor animal survival and non-survival surgery for specimen collection and characterization. 7. Experience with in vivo imaging modalities and the evaluation of tissues and biological fluids for molecular and/or biochemical endpoints are desired. 8.
